The scene at Kissko leans high-energy lounge with live music and DJ sets, shisha clouds, and a floor team that likes to put on a show. Guests rave about friendly servers by name and little moments like a magician at the table. One diner put it simply: the vibe is a whole night out. However, there are some review authenticity concerns - some review patterns are consistent with solicited or influenced feedback. In the kitchen, expect Moroccan staples alongside creative international twists—think brisket and lamb shank next to kefta tagine, or sea bass ceviche brightened with yuzu. Plates arrive polished and photo-ready, with flavors that most guests find satisfying, especially on non-peak nights. The approach suits diners who enjoy modern lounge dining where entertainment and presentation are part of the draw. Families do fine here thanks to accessible dishes like the cheeseburger and rigatoni, fries, and playful desserts, plus music and magic that keep kids engaged. Vegetarians will find limited options, and shisha smoke plus loud music may not suit younger children. Note the alcohol-free policy; mocktails are the thing.
